{"data":{"id":"us-ca/rtc-24308.10","jurisdiction":"us-ca","citation":"RTC § 24308.10","heading":"","body":"(a) For taxable years beginning on or after January 1, 2024, and before January 1, 2029, gross income shall not include any amount received by a qualified taxpayer as a California qualified wildfire loss mitigation payment.\n(b) For purposes of this section, the following definitions apply:\n(1) “California qualified wildfire loss mitigation payment” means any amount which is received through the California Wildfire Mitigation Financial Assistance Program under Article 16.5 (commencing with Section 8654.2) of Chapter 7 of Division 1 of Title 2 of the Government Code for the benefit of a residential property owner or occupant with expenses paid, or obligations incurred, for wildfire loss mitigation.\n(2) “Qualified taxpayer” means a taxpayer that owns the structure for which a California qualified wildfire loss mitigation payment was received.\n(3) “Wildfire loss mitigation” means an activity that reduces wildfire risks to a residential structure or its contents, or both.\n(c) This section shall remain in effect only until December 1, 2029, and as of that date is repealed.","path":["Revenue and Taxation Code - RTC","DIVISION 2.
